WebThus nearly all large RNA virus clonal populations are quasispecies collections of differing, related genomes (14, 49). These rapidly mutating populations can remain remarkably stable under certain conditions of replication. Under other conditions, virus-population equilibria become disturbed, and extremely rapid evolution can result. WebInfluenza viruses change in two main ways, antigenic drift and antigenic shift. WebViruses are simple entities, lacking an energy-generating system and having very limited biosynthetic capabilities. The smallest viruses have only a few genes; the largest viruses have as many as 200. Genetically, however, viruses have many features in common with cells. Viruses are subject to mutations, the genomes of different viruses can recombine …
